#5950c5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#5950c5 is composed of 34.9% red, 31.4%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.8% cyan, 59.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 244.6 degrees, a saturation of 50.2% and a lightness of 54.3%. #5950c5 color hex could be obtained by blending #b2a0ff with #00008b.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

● #5950c5 color description : Moderate blue.
#5950c5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#5950c5 has RGB values of R:89, G:80, B:197 and CMYK values of C:0.55, M:0.59, Y:0,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 5853381.
